Web23 hours ago · According to the NH Fiscal Policy Institute (NHFPI), New Hampshire’s Choices for Independence program has had a structural deficit of $153 million from fiscal years 2011 to 2024. Providers cannot recruit and retain workers and cover costs. A shrinking workforce means that more people are going without the care they need.
